CVE-2026-14292
5.4
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N
Summary
The Download Manager WordPress plugin before 3.3.66 does not properly escape a package's title before outputting it in the front-end package templates, allowing users with the Author role or above to store a title that results in arbitrary JavaScript execution in the browser of any user, including unauthenticated visitors, who views a page displaying the package.
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Version Range | Status |
|---|---|---|---|
| Unknown | Download Manager | 0 < 3.3.66 | affected |
Weaknesses
- CWE-79 Cross-Site Scripting (XSS)
ADP Enrichment
CISA ADP Vulnrichment
- SSVC:
- Exploitation: poc
- Automatable: no
- Technical Impact: partial
